  • According to the Hurun Global Unicorn Index 2024, the pace of unicorn startups in India has slowed down after 2017. This report describes India as the third largest unicorn center in the world.
  • The Hurun Global Unicorn Index has been published since 2000 and only includes startups that have a valuation of at least USD 1 billion and are not listed on any stock exchanges. According to Hurun Research, there are a total of 1,453 unicorns located in 291 cities in 53 countries globally. According to the report, a unicorn is formed every two minutes in the world.
  • The San Francisco Bay Area, located in California, United States, is the unicorn capital of the world.
  • India had 67 unicorns in 2022, which decreased by one in 2023.
